Output fa89831cdcb59cb61d64c0d010c11147c532cef3030bec4e75fedd9c46769922:1

value
22261490
script pubkey
OP_0 OP_PUSHBYTES_20 3ffaf56f3cf4c7b4c5322787c2ed81a35889099d
address
bc1q8la02meu7nrmf3fjy7ru9mvp5dvgjzvatvcfjp
transaction
fa89831cdcb59cb61d64c0d010c11147c532cef3030bec4e75fedd9c46769922
confirmations
171011
spent
true